ill be honest. if someone says these engines are hard to change the oil and drain pan is to small and oil spooges everywhere, its rubs me the wrong way because i know better. with some thought (very little) and simple enginuity (small piece of cardboard like puzza box any other small flat piece of material laying around the house to hold between draglink and funnel opening) you hardly spill a drop.
when the filter is fully unthreaded dont pull it off the block or you get a big rush of oil . keep light pressure and tilt it slightly or just barely pull it away from the block. now the big gush is a managable small stream right into the funnel and into your drain pan
ive found these 6.4 to be easy and mess free. try changing a toyota 3.4 upside dow filter and not dump it on your face
